παλ-εύτρια

paleutria · ἡ

Generated live from the audited corpus — every figure on this page is a database query, not prose from memory.

What it meant — LSJ

fem. of παλευτής, Arist. HA 613a23: as Adj., πελειάδες Ael. NA 13.17: metaph., of courtesans, φιλῳδοὶ κερμάτων π. Eub. 84.1:—also παλ-ευτρίς, ίδος, ἡ, Phot.
